If each vowel in the word DOMAINS is changed to next letter in English alphabetical series and each consonant is changed to previous letter in English alphabetical series and then all alphabets in the word thus formed is arranged in alphabetical order (from left to right), which of the following will be third from the right end of the new arrangement thus formed?


A) J

B) C

C) P

D) M

E) B

Correct Answer:
D) M

Description for Correct answer:
B C J L M P R
